USA: Bikers ride from New Orleans to Chicago on pro-life mission

April 19, 2012

When it comes to saving babies, you could say they’re going the extra mile – 1,150 of them, to be exact.

By LifeSiteNews staff | posted 4/13/2012

This entry was posted in Headlines and tagged , , , , . Bookmark the permalink. Both comments and trackbacks are currently closed.

Latest News